I've been looking at the QMP and TTi brackets. I've ordered the QMP and hope to see it today. In both cases, it appears that belt tension is limited because of the proximity of the alternator pulley to the the tensioner. That is compounded by limited clearance of the belt between the crank pulley and the tensioner because of the water pump hose fitting. I'm going to investigate more because I think you could purchase an additional 3" idler pulley (the one to the right of the crank pulley) and install it using a spacer and longer bolt at the bottom of the tensioner. That would allow you to get more tension and contact from the tensioner and move the belt away from the WP hose fitting. Whatca think?

That would work good except My kit don`t have the idler pulley between the crank and PS pump, but you have the right idea. The whole problem is becase the crank pulley is trying to turn all these accessories and theres only about 7-8in of belt touching the crank pulley, it needs more wrap.
